Food Innovators Holdings  (SGX:KYB) ROA % Explanation

ROA % measures the rate of return on the total assets (shareholder equity plus liabilities). It meas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from shareholders' equity plus its liabilities. ROA % shows how well a company uses what it has to generate earnings. ROA %s can vary drastically across industries. Therefore, ROA % should not be used to compare companies in different industries. For retailers, a ROA % of higher than 5% is expected. For example, Wal-Mart (WMT) has a ROA % of about 8% as of 2012. For banks, ROA % is close to their interest spread. A bank’s ROA % is typically well under 2%.

Similar to ROE, ROA % is affected by profit margins and asset turnover. This can be seen from the Du Pont Formula:

ROA %(Q: Feb. 2026 )
=Net Income/Total Assets
=-0.032/60.5845
=(Net Income / Revenue)*(Revenue / Total Assets)
=(-0.032 / 44.936)*(44.936 / 60.5845)
=Net Margin %*Asset Turnover
=-0.07 %*0.7417
=-0.05 %

Be Aware

Like ROE, ROA % is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in the company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ective. ROA % can be affected by events such as stock buyback or issuance, and by goodwill, a company's tax rate and its interest payment. ROA % may not reflect the true earning power of the assets. A more accurate measurement is ROC % (ROC).

Many analysts argue the higher return the better. Buffett states that really high ROA % may indicate vulnerability in the durability of the competitive advantage.

E.g. Raising $43b to take on KO is impossible, but $1.7b to take on Moody's is. Although Moody's ROA % and underlying economics is far superior to Coca Cola, the durability is far weaker because of lower entry cost.

Food Innovators Holdings Business Description

Address 5-18-11 Nishi-Ikebukuro, Dai-3 Aiwa Building, 5th Floor, Toshima-ku, Tokyo, JPN, 171-0021
Food Innovators Holdings Ltd is a multi-market operator in the food and beverage industry. Along with its subsidiaries, the company operates in two business segments: the Restaurant Leasing and Subleasing Business (RLSB) and the Food Retail Business (FRB). Maximum revenue is generated from its Food Retail Business, which owns and operates restaurants featuring menus that showcase Japanese cuisine and Japanese-inspired European offerings. In addition, it also provides F&B Consulting and Operations Management Services. The Restaurant Leasing and Subleasing Business (RLSB) segment leases restaurant premises from landlords and subleases them to restaurant tenants. Geographically, the group generates maximum revenue from Japan, followed by Singapore, Malaysia, and Taiwan.
